Output 8908fbb69f1d138ae48d3cd3578b7c6866c394ea299777f084fae795d4026e74:4

value
28034763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7ab0d14ff7460a561d10532d34d1c9491c36f99 OP_EQUAL
address
MQeJoNeZrG4FSVSuWYrUsFpvcWk1UStidS
transaction
8908fbb69f1d138ae48d3cd3578b7c6866c394ea299777f084fae795d4026e74
spent
true